Transaction 04368f7127ae4fba960409b7d3f9d46220830b5162a3fd402412d5df87e38a78
1 Input
1 Output
-
04368f7127ae4fba960409b7d3f9d46220830b5162a3fd402412d5df87e38a78:0
- value
- 150000
- script pubkey
- OP_0 OP_PUSHBYTES_20 e4503bdb6ed60971b2dd7a61e6990c2c7cbd2ac4
- address
- bc1qu3grhkmw6cyhrvka0fs7dxgv937t62kyfrtja6